I've been playing older versions to pass time until A21 drops and there was a time things degraded when repaired. It was removed so don't know if they will change it back in future but who knows.

According to Roland, this is rather unlikely. Reimplementing item degradation would require a lot of rebalancing.

 

In A21, things will change in that respect anyway. Currently you can reach quality level 5 pretty fast for everything you craft, but in A21 you will have to climb up the quality levels separately for each technology level. After the quality 5 iron pickaxe comes the quality 1 steel pickaxe. You will re-craft your weapons and tools multiple times.
